Abstract
The characteristics of composite carbon films are experimentally studied. The films are synthesized under concurrent conditions of the magnetron and plasmatron sputtering of molybdenum disilicide and polyphenyl methylsiloxane (PPMS 2/5). Automodulation of the elemental and phase composition is found and studied in the direction of film deposition onto the substrate. The stability of the automodulation parameters to subsequent high-temperature annealing is examined.
